Know Your Lip Type

Lip care For Different Skin TYpes

Lips are one of the most sensitive and delicate parts of our body, and they require proper care and attention to maintain their health and beauty. But did you know that the type of lip care you need depends on your skin type? Yes, that’s right! Just like the skin on your face, your lips also have different skin types, and the care they need may vary.
Dry Lips:
- Dry lips are a common problem, and they are characterized by chapped, peeling, and flaky skin. If you have dry lips, it means that your skin lacks natural oils and moisture. To take care of dry lips, you need to use a lip balm that contains ingredients like beeswax, shea butter, and petroleum jelly. These ingredients will help to lock in the moisture and keep your lips hydrated. You should also avoid using lip products that contain alcohol, as it can further dry out your lips.
Sensitive Lips:
- Sensitive lips are prone to irritation and allergies, and they require special care. To take care of sensitive lips, you need to use lip products that are free from harsh chemicals and fragrances. You can also use a lip balm that contains ingredients like aloe vera and vitamin E, as they are known to soothe and protect sensitive skin.

How Much Can You Receive for Lost Future Income?

- Are You Able to Do the Same Kind of Work You Did Before Your Accident?
- How Are These Damages Calculated?
- Your Georgia Injury Lawyer Can Certainly Demand Damages for Lost Future Income
When our Douglasville personal injury lawyers first sit down with a new client, one of the first things they want to know is how much their case is worth. The first thing we tell them is that we can never give any client an exact figure about how much their case is worth. We can certainly give you a ballpark figure and let you know what we believe your case is valued at.
Aside from the obvious compensation for medical bills and property damage, there is also something called lost future income. These are damages that our clients are entitled to when they can no longer do the same work they did before their accident. Your Georgia injury lawyer must be able to prove that you are going to earn less as a result of your accident. If you find a job making just as much or more than you did before the accident, you can’t expect the court to grant you damages for lost drinking period
House Republicans To Vote On Bill Abolishing IRS And Eliminating Income Tax
Republicans in the House of Representatives will follow through on a promise and will vote on a bill that would abolish the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) and eliminate the national income tax.
The House will vote on Georgia Republican Rep. Buddy Carter’s reintroduced Fair Tax Act because it was part of the deal between House Speaker Kevin McCarthy, R-Calif., and members of the House Freedom Caucus to give Kevin the gavel
Carter said: “Cosponsoring this Georgia-made legislation was my first act as a Member of Congress and is, fittingly, the first bill I am introducing in the 118th Congress. Instead of adding 87,000 new agents to weaponize the IRS against small business owners and middle America, this bill will eliminate the need for the department entirely by simplifying the tax code with provisions that work for the American people and encourage growth and innovation.
“Armed, unelected bureaucrats should not have more power over your paycheck than you do.”
Rep. Jeff Duncan, R-S.C. said:
“As a former small business owner, I understand the unnecessary burden our failing income tax system has on Americans.
“The Fair Tax Act eliminates the tax code, replaces the income tax with a sales tax, and abolishes the abusive Internal Revenue Service.
“If enacted, this will invigorate the American taxpayer and help more Americans achieve the American Dream.”
“I support the Fair Tax because it simplifies our tax code,” said Rep. Bob Good, R-Va.
“This transforms the U.S. tax code from a mandatory, progressive, and convoluted system to a fully transparent and unbiased system which does away with the IRS as we know it.

The Record $75M Verdict, Pt. 2
“Face the Jury” is a podcast dedicated to all issues involving medical malpractice – what it is, how to spot it and how to prevent it while protecting yourself and your family.
Today, Laura Shamp returns to Face the Jury to continue our conversation about our shared $75M medical malpractice verdict – the largest in Georgia history. In Part 1, we talked to Laura about Jonathan Buckelew’s “locked-in” case and the preparation that goes into a years-long case. Today, we round out that discussion.
Lloyd: Laura, you told me that Jonathan Buckelew’s case was one of the most impactful cases in your career. I’d like you to talk about it, how the trial went and how it impacted you.
Laura: When you have a catastrophically injured patient like Jonathan, you feel a great responsibility to that patient to get them justice. I certainly felt that burden trying this case. It puts a lot of pressure on you as a lawyer.
Half of my clients are wrongful death cases where the patient is deceased. This case was highly complicated and intellectually challenging for my team and me. We had to understand the medicine and then present the details in a way a layperson could understand.
I have read hundreds of articles about stroke and stroke care. There are a lot of different kinds of strokes, and the type in this case is probably the worst. One of the defense arguments was that this was such a bad stroke that no intervention would have made a difference even if our doctors had done the right thing. The difficulty from a lawyer’s perspective, we had to understand all of this and then present it simply. Lloyd, you help with this.
